189-8047-6739

全链数字化私域运营服务

您当前位置> 主页 > 私域讲堂 > 运营百科

新零售商城系统开发流程介绍

发表时间:2024-10-06 11:34:53

文章作者:小编

浏览次数:

新零售商城系统的开发是一个复杂而细致的过程,涉及多个阶段和关键环节。以下是新零售商城系统开发流程的详细介绍:


一、需求分析阶段

此阶段的主要任务是深入了解新零售业务、目标市场、竞争对手以及消费者的购买行为等信息,明确商城系统的定位和功能需求。

包括:

市场调研:了解目标市场的规模、潜力、竞争格局以及消费者的偏好和需求。

功能规划:基于调研结果,规划商城系统应具备的功能,如商品展示、搜索、下单、支付、物流查询、会员管理、数据分析等。

需求文档:制定详细的系统需求文档,为后续开发工作提供明确的方向和依据。


二、系统设计阶段

在设计阶段,开发团队会根据需求分析的结果,进一步设计系统的架构、数据库模型、界面布局等。

包括:

架构设计:设计商城系统的整体架构,包括前端界面、后端服务、数据库等,确保系统的可扩展性、稳定性和安全性。

UI/UX设计:设计简洁美观、操作流畅的用户界面和交互流程,提升用户体验。

数据库设计:设计合理的数据库结构,存储商品信息、用户信息、订单信息等关键数据。


三、编码实现阶段

在编码阶段,开发团队会根据设计文档和规范进行编码工作。

包括:

前端开发:选择合适的前端框架和库(如React、Vue等),实现商城系统的前端界面和交互逻辑。

后端开发:选择适合的后端语言和框架(如Java、Python的Django、Flask,或Node.js等),实现系统的业务逻辑和数据处理。

模块化开发:按照功能规划,将商城系统划分为多个模块(如商品管理、订单管理、会员管理等),进行模块化开发。


四、测试与优化阶段

在测试阶段,开发团队会对系统进行全面的测试,包括单元测试、集成测试和系统测试等。测试的目的是发现并修复潜在的问题和漏洞,确保系统的稳定性和可靠性。此外,还需要进行性能优化,提升系统的运行效率和响应速度。


五、部署与上线阶段

在部署阶段,开发团队会将系统部署到生产环境中。这个过程需要考虑到数据迁移、系统配置、安全性等问题,以确保系统的顺利上线。同时,还需要进行上线前的终测试和调试,确保系统稳定可靠后正式上线运营。


六、运营与维护阶段

系统上线后,开发团队需要定期进行系统维护和更新,包括修复漏洞、改进功能、增加新特性等。此外,还需要提供用户支持和技术服务,解决用户在使用过程中遇到的问题。同时,利用数据分析工具分析用户行为和市场趋势,为商城系统的优化和决策提供数据支持。


综上所述,新零售商城系统开发流程包括需求分析、系统设计、编码实现、测试与优化、部署与上线以及运营与维护等多个阶段。每个阶段都有其特定的任务和目标,需要开发团队严格按照流程进行开发工作,以确保系统的稳定性、安全性和用户体验。